The Location of the Reeves Cemetery ...
We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Reeves Cemetery:
36.5759, -85.7980
The Reeves Cemetery is located in Clay County<2>.
The county seat for Clay County is located in Celina. Celina lies 16 miles [25.7 km]<3> to the east of the Reeves Cemetery .

- Referenced GNIS Record ...
- GNIS ID #1299187 (Reeves Cemetery)
- Note: In 2021, GNIS record #1299187 was archived by the USGS. It is no longer maintained by the USGS, nor can it be retrieved from their website. In the past, the GNIS record contained the following information:
- BGN Class: cemetery
- County: Clay
- Est. Elev: 275 (in feet)
- Topo Map Name: Red Boiling Springs
- Location given for Reeves Cemetery:
- Lat: 36.5761675 Lon: -85.7977557
